v2.21.2

What's Changed

Full Changelog: ruby/json@v2.21.1...v2.21.2

v2.21.0

What's Changed

  • JSON.generate now accept a sort_keys option, which takes either a boolean or a block.
  • Added #empty? and #partial_value? methods on JSON::ResumableParser.
  • Numerous correctness and performance fixes for JSON::ResumableParser.
  • Avoid triggering Ruby's float out of range warning when parsing out of range numbers.
  • Declare C types with Ruby 4.1 RUBY_TYPED_THREAD_SAFE_FREE.

Full Changelog: ruby/json@v2.20.0...v2.21.0

v2.20.0

What's Changed

  • Both C and Java parsers are no longer recursive, so parsing very deep documents with max_nesting: false will no longer result in SystemStackError stack level too deep errors.
    • The :max_nesting option still defaults to 100.
  • Optimized floating point number parsing further by replacing the ryu algorithm by a port of Eisel-Lemire Fast Float.
  • Added JSON::ResumableParser to parse streams of JSON documents. Not yet available on JRuby.
  • Deprecate default support of JavaScript comments in the parser and add allow_comments: true parsing option.
  • Integrate with Ruby 4.1 ruby_sized_xfree.

Full Changelog: ruby/json@v2.19.8...v2.20.0

Updates nokogiri from 1.18.9 to 1.19.4

Release notes

Sourced from nokogiri's releases.

v1.19.4 / 2026-06-18

Security

  • [CRuby] (Low) Fixed a possible invalid memory read when XML::Node#initialize_copy_with_args is called with an argument that is not a Node. See GHSA-g9g8-vgvw-g3vf for more information.
  • [CRuby] (Low) Fixed a possible use-after-free when an XML::XPathContext is used after its source document has been garbage collected. See GHSA-p67v-3w7g-wjg7 for more information.
  • [CRuby] (Low) Fixed a possible use-after-free during XInclude processing via Node#do_xinclude. See GHSA-wfpw-mmfh-qq69 for more information.
  • [CRuby] (Low) Fixed a possible use-after-free when Document#root= is assigned a non-element node. See GHSA-wjv4-x9w8-wm3h for more information.
  • [CRuby] (Low) Fixed a possible use-after-free when setting an attribute value via XML::Attr#value= or #content=. See GHSA-phwj-rprq-35pp for more information.
  • [CRuby] (Low) Fixed a null pointer dereference when methods are called on uninitialized wrapper objects (e.g. via allocate); these now raise instead of crashing the process. See GHSA-9cv2-cfxc-v4v2 for more information.
  • [CRuby] (Low) Fixed a possible use-after-free when Document#encoding= raises an exception. See GHSA-5v8h-3h3q-446p for more information.
  • [CRuby] (Medium) Fixed an out-of-bounds read in XML::NodeSet#[] (alias #slice) when given a large negative index. See GHSA-5prr-v3j2-97mh for more information.
  • [JRuby] (Low) XML::Schema now enforces the NONET parse option, which Nokogiri enables by default. It was not enforced on JRuby, so a schema parsed with default options could still fetch external resources over the network, potentially enabling SSRF or XXE attacks and bypassing the mitigation for CVE-2020-26247. See GHSA-8678-w3jw-xfc2 for more information.
